PHOTOS: Aiyepeku Celebrates With Medal Winning Lagos Swimmers

Posted on September 27, 2023

The Executive Chairman, Lagos State Sports Commission, Mr Sola Aiyepeku was at the venue of swimming events in the ongoing 7th National Youth Games on Wednesday to feel the positive vibes creating by the young swimmers competing in Lagos State colours in Asaba, Delta State.

The young swimmers (boys and girls) from Lagos have been so fantastic in their performance as they have been able to haul a considerable number of medals in various colours to the kitty of Team Lagos while many more are still coming with the swimming events getting so hot by the day.

Wednesday morning, the following medals were won.
50M Breaststroke Boys- BRONZE
50M Butterfly Girls- GOLD
50M Butterfly Boys- BRONZE
4×50M Mixed Medley Relay- GOLD
